Ja.rc 12.1 KB
Newer Older
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
/*
 * Wine command prompt
 * Japanese Language Support
 *
 * Copyright (C) 2004 Hajime Segawa
 *
 * This library is free software; you can redistribute it and/or
 * modify it under the terms of the GNU Lesser General Public
 * License as published by the Free Software Foundation; either
 * version 2.1 of the License, or (at your option) any later version.
 *
 * This library is distributed in the hope that it will be useful,
 * but WITHOUT ANY WARRANTY; without even the implied warranty of
 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
 * Lesser General Public License for more details.
 *
 * You should have received a copy of the GNU Lesser General Public
 * License along with this library; if not, write to the Free Software
19
 *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
20 21
 */

22 23
#include "wcmd.h"

24 25 26
/* UTF-8 */
#pragma code_page(65001)

27 28 29 30
LANGUAGE LANG_JAPANESE, SUBLANG_DEFAULT

STRINGTABLE
{
31
  WCMD_ATTRIB, "ATTRIBのヘルプ\n"
32
  WCMD_CALL,
33 34 35 36
"CALL <バッチファイル名> は他のバッチファイルからコマンドを実行する場合\n\
にバッチファイル中で使用します。バッチファイル終了時にコントロールは呼\n\
び出したファイルに戻ります。 CALL コマンドは呼び出される手続きにパラメ\n\
ータを渡すことが可能です。\n\
37
\n\
38 39
呼び出された手続きが行ったカレントディレクトリや環境変数の変更は呼び出\n\
し元に引き継がれます。\n"
40

41 42
  WCMD_CD,     "CDのヘルプ\n"
  WCMD_CHDIR,  "CHDIRのヘルプ\n"
43

44
  WCMD_CLS,    "CLSはコンソール画面をクリアします\n"
45

46 47 48 49 50
  WCMD_COPY,   "COPYのヘルプ\n"
  WCMD_CTTY,   "CTTYのヘルプ\n"
  WCMD_DATE,   "DATEのヘルプ\n"
  WCMD_DEL,    "DELのヘルプ\n"
  WCMD_DIR,    "DIRのヘルプ\n"
51 52

  WCMD_ECHO,
53
"ECHO <文字列> は<文字列>を現在のターミナルに表示します。\n\
54
\n\
55 56
ECHO ON は以降にバッチファイルで実行するコマンドを実行前に\n\
ターミナルに表示するようにします。\n\
57
\n\
58 59 60
ECHO OFF はECHO ONの逆の効果を持ちます。 (ECHOはデフォルト\n\
ではOFFです)。ECHO OFF コマンドは@マークに続けて実行すれば\n\
表示されません。\n"
61

62
  WCMD_ERASE,  "ERASEのヘルプ\n"
63 64

  WCMD_FOR,
65 66
"FOR コマンドはそれぞれのファイルに対してコマンドを実行する\n\
場合に使用します。\n\
67
\n\
68
文法: FOR %変数 IN (セット) DO コマンド\n\
69
\n\
70 71
cmd内に存在しないバッチファイル中でFORを使用する場合は%記号\n\
を二重にする必要があります。\n"
72 73

  WCMD_GOTO,
74 75
"GOTO コマンドはバッチファイル中で実行行を他のステートメントに\n\
移します。\n\
76
\n\
77 78 79 80 81
GOTO 文のターゲットとなるラベルは半角255文字以内ですが、空白\n\
を含んではいけません。(これは他のオペレーティングシステムでは\n\
異なります)。二つ以上同一のラベルが存在する場合は常に最初の物\n\
が実行されます。GOTO文に存在しないラベルを指定した場合はバッ\n\
チファイルの実行を中断します。\n\
82
\n\
83
GOTO は対話モードで使用された場合は意味を持ちません。\n"
84

85
  WCMD_HELP,   "HELPのヘルプ\n"
86 87

  WCMD_IF,
88
"IF は条件に基づいてコマンドを実行する場合に使用します。\n\
89
\n\
90 91 92
文法:	IF [NOT] EXIST ファイル名 コマンド\n\
	IF [NOT] 文字列1==文字列2 コマンド\n\
	IF [NOT] ERRORLEVEL 番号 コマンド\n\
93
\n\
94 95
二番目の形式において、文字列1と文字列2はダブルクオートで囲われ\n\
ていなければなりません。大文字と小文字は区別されません。\n"
96

97
  WCMD_LABEL,  "LABEL はディスクのボリュームラベルを設定する場合に使用します。\n\
98
\n\
99 100 101
文法: LABEL [ドライブ:]\n\
コマンドを実行すると指定したドライブの新しいボリューム名を要求します。\n\
ディスクのボリュームラベルはVOLコマンドで表示できます。\n"
102

103 104
  WCMD_MD,     "MDのヘルプ\n"
  WCMD_MKDIR,  "MKDIRのヘルプ\n"
105
  WCMD_MOVE,
106
"MOVE はファイルまたはディレクトリをファイルシステム中で新しい場所に移動します。\n\
107
\n\
108 109
移動する対象がディレクトリの場合は、ディレクトリ内の全てのファ\n\
イルとサブディレクトリも移動します。\n\
110
\n\
111
MOVE では移動元と移動先のドライブレターが異なる場合、移動は失敗します。\n"
112 113

  WCMD_PATH,
114
"PATH はcmdの検索パスを表示または変更します。\n\
115
\n\
116 117 118 119
PATH と入力すると現在のパス設定を表示します(初期状態では\n\
wine.confファイル中で指定された物になっています)。設定を\n\
変更するには、PATHコマンドに続けて新しい設定値を入力して\n\
下さい。\n\
120
\n\
121 122
パスを変更するときにPATH環境変数を使用することも可能です。\n\
例えば:\n\
123
		PATH %PATH%;c:\\temp\n"
124 125

  WCMD_PAUSE,
126 127 128 129
"PAUSE は画面に「続けるにはリターンキーを押して下さい」と\n\
表示し、ユーザがリターンキーを押すのを待機します。これは\n\
主にバッチファイル中で実行されたコマンドの結果がスクロー\n\
ルする前にユーザが読めるようにしたい場合に有用です。\n"
130 131

  WCMD_PROMPT,
132
"PROMPT はコマンドプロンプトを設定します。\n\
133
\n\
134 135
PROMPT コマンド(と直後のスペース)に続く文字列はcmdが入力待ちの時、\n\
行の先頭に表示されます。\n\
136
\n\
137
以下のキャラクタ文字列は特別な意味を持ちます:\n\
138
\n\
139 140 141 142
$$    ドル記号            $_    改行                $b    パイプ記号 (|)\n\
$d    現在の日付          $e    エスケープ          $g    > 記号\n\
$l    < 記号              $n    現在のドライブ      $p    現在のパス\n\
$q    等号                $t    現在の時刻          $v    cmdのバージョン\n\
143
\n\
144 145 146 147
注意:PROMPTコマンドをプロンプト文字列なしで実行すると、デフォルト値にリ\n\
セットされます。 デフォルト値はカレントディレクトリ(ドライブ名を含みます)\n\
に続いて大なり(>)記号です。\n\
(PROMPT $p$g を実行した時と同様です)\n\
148
\n\
149 150
プロンプトはPROMPT環境変数を編集することでも変更できます。\n\
したがって、'SET PROMPT=文字列'と'PROMPT 文字列'の効果は同じです。\n"
151 152

  WCMD_REM,
153 154
"REM(と直後のスペース)で始まるコマンドは実行されません。\n\
したがって、バッチファイル中のコメントとして使用できます。\n"
155

156 157 158 159
  WCMD_REN,    "RENのヘルプ\n"
  WCMD_RENAME, "RENAMEのヘルプ\n"
  WCMD_RD,     "RDのヘルプ\n"
  WCMD_RMDIR,  "RMDIRのヘルプ\n"
160 161

  WCMD_SET,
162
"SET はcmdの環境変数を表示または変更します。\n\
163
\n\
164
パラメータなしでSETを実行すると、現在の全ての環境変数を表示します。\n\
165
\n\
166
環境変数の作成または変更を行う場合は次のように記述して下さい:\n\
167
\n\
168
      SET <環境変数名>=<値>\n\
169
\n\
170 171 172
<環境変数名> と <値> は文字列です。等号の手前にスペースを\n\
入れないで下さい。手前にスペースを入れると環境変数名に余分\n\
なスペースが含まれてしまう場合があります。\n\
173
\n\
174 175 176 177
Wine環境では、Wineが動作しているOSの環境変数がWin32環境変数に含\n\
まれます。したがって、ネイティブWin32環境より多くの値がセットさ\n\
れています。cmd内からOSの環境変数を変更することができないこと\n\
に注意して下さい。\n"
178 179

  WCMD_SHIFT,
180 181 182
"SHIFT はバッチファイル中でリストの先頭から一つのパラメータを取り除く時\n\
に使用します。つまり、パラメータ2がパラメータ1になります。コマンドライン\n\
から呼ばれたときには何も起こりません。\n"
183

184
  WCMD_TIME,   "TIMEのヘルプ\n"
185

186
  WCMD_TITLE,  "cmdウィンドウのウィンドウタイトルを設定します。文法 TITLE [文字列]\n"
187 188

  WCMD_TYPE,
189 190 191
"TYPE <ファイル名> は <ファイル名> をコンソールデバイス(又はリダイレクト\n\
された所)にコピーします。ファイルが可読なテキストファイルかどうかチェック\n\
されません。\n"
192 193

  WCMD_VERIFY,
194
"VERIFY はverifyフラグをセット、クリア、又はテストする時に使用します。有効なフォームは:\n\
195
\n\
196 197 198
VERIFY ON	フラグをセット\n\
VERIFY OFF	フラグをクリア\n\
VERIFY		ONかOFFか表示\n\
199
\n\
200
Wine環境ではverifyフラグは意味を持ちません。\n"
201 202

  WCMD_VER,
203
"VER は動作しているcmdのバージョンを表示します\n"
204

205
  WCMD_VOL,    "VOLのヘルプ\n"
206

207 208 209 210 211 212
  WCMD_PUSHD,  "PUSHD <directoryname> saves the current directory onto a\n\
stack, and then changes the current directory to the supplied one.\n"

  WCMD_POPD,   "POPD changes current directory to the last one saved with\n\
PUSHD.\n"

213 214
  WCMD_MORE,   "MORE displays output of files or piped input in pages.\n"

215
  WCMD_EXIT,
216 217 218 219 220 221 222 223 224 225 226 227 228 229 230
"EXIT は現在のコマンドセッションを終了してcmdを呼び出したOSまたはシェルに戻します。\n"

  WCMD_ALLHELP, "CMD 内蔵のコマンド:\n\
ATTRIB\t\tDOSファイルの属性を表示又は変更\n\
CALL\t\t外部のバッチファイルを呼び出し\n\
CD (CHDIR)\tカレントディレクトリを変更\n\
CLS\t\tコンソール画面をクリア\n\
COPY\t\tファイルをコピー\n\
CTTY\t\t入力/出力デバイスを変更\n\
DATE\t\tシステムの日付を表示又は変更\n\
DEL (ERASE)\tファイルを削除\n\
DIR\t\tディレクトリの内容を表示\n\
ECHO\t\t文字列を直接コンソール出力にコピー\n\
HELP\t\tトピックの詳細なヘルプを表示\n\
MD (MKDIR)\tサブディレクトリを作成\n\
231
MORE\t\tDisplay output in pages\n\
232 233
MOVE\t\tファイルまたはディレクトリツリーを移動\n\
PATH\t\tパスを表示又は設定\n\
234
POPD\t\tRestores the directory to the last one saved with PUSHD\n\
235
PROMPT\t\tコマンドプロンプトを変更\n\
236
PUSHD\t\tChanges to a new directory, saving the current one\n\
237 238 239 240 241 242 243 244 245 246
REN (RENAME)\tファイルをリネーム\n\
RD (RMDIR)\tサブディレクトリを削除\n\
SET\t\t環境変数を設定又は表示\n\
TIME\t\tシステムの時刻を設定又は表示\n\
TITLE\t\tCMDセッションのウィンドウタイトルを設定\n\
TYPE\t\tテキストファイルの内容を出力\n\
VER\t\tCMDのバージョンを表示\n\
VOL\t\tディスクデバイスのボリュームラベルを表示\n\
EXIT\t\tCMDを終了\n\n\
上記のコマンドに関する詳細を表示するには HELP <コマンド名> と入力して下さい。\n"
247 248 249 250

  WCMD_CONFIRM, "Are you sure"
  WCMD_YES, "Y"
  WCMD_NO, "N"
251
  WCMD_NOASSOC, "File association missing for extension %s\n"
252
  WCMD_NOFTYPE, "No open command associated with file type '%s'\n"
253
  WCMD_OVERWRITE, "Overwrite %s"
254
  WCMD_MORESTR, "More..."
255 256 257 258 259 260 261 262 263 264 265 266 267 268 269 270 271 272 273 274 275 276
  WCMD_TRUNCATEDLINE, "Line in Batch processing possibly truncated. Using:\n"
  WCMD_NYI, "Not Yet Implemented\n\n"
  WCMD_NOARG, "Argument missing\n"
  WCMD_SYNTAXERR, "Syntax error\n"
  WCMD_FILENOTFOUND, "%s : File Not Found\n"
  WCMD_NOCMDHELP, "No help available for %s\n"
  WCMD_NOTARGET, "Target to GOTO not found\n"
  WCMD_CURRENTDATE, "Current Date is %s\n"
  WCMD_CURRENTTIME, "Current Time is %s\n"
  WCMD_NEWDATE, "Enter new date: "
  WCMD_NEWTIME, "Enter new time: "
  WCMD_MISSINGENV, "Environment variable %s not defined\n"
  WCMD_READFAIL, "Failed to open '%s'\n"
  WCMD_CALLINSCRIPT, "Cannot call batch label outside of a batch script\n"
  WCMD_ALL, "A"
  WCMD_DELPROMPT, "%s, Delete"
  WCMD_ECHOPROMPT, "Echo is %s\n"
  WCMD_VERIFYPROMPT, "Verify is %s\n"
  WCMD_VERIFYERR, "Verify must be ON or OFF\n";
  WCMD_ARGERR, "Parameter error\n"
  WCMD_VOLUMEDETAIL, "Volume in drive %c is %s\nVolume Serial Number is %04x-%04x\n\n"
  WCMD_VOLUMEPROMPT, "Volume label (11 characters, ENTER for none)?"
277 278 279 280
  WCMD_NOPATH, "PATH not found\n"
  WCMD_ANYKEY,"Press Return key to continue: "
  WCMD_CONSTITLE,"Wine Command Prompt"
  WCMD_VERSION,"CMD Version %s\n\n"
281
  WCMD_MOREPROMPT, "More? "
282
  WCMD_LINETOOLONG, "The input line is too long.\n"
283
}